Congo explores Belgian sanitation expertise and industrial economic shifts

In Brazzaville, Belgium's Ambassador Emmanuelle Plissart De Foy has proposed technical expertise to the Congolese Minister of Urban Sanitation, Juste Désiré Mondelé. The discussions focused on waste management, urban planning, and the circular economy, aiming to transform waste into resources through recycling and reuse. The cooperation intends to address sanitation issues on land, in rivers, and at sea.

Simultaneously, the President of the Congolese Senate, Pierre Ngolo, has called for a shift from a purely extractive economy toward industrial transformation. This appeal for economic diversification comes as the Senate approved four oil contract amendments during an extraordinary session. The legislative body is set to examine production sharing contracts for Banga Kayo II, Holmoni, and Cayo as part of its ongoing sessions.
